工科菜鸟的Matplotlib绘图分享--NO.1 环境搭建及初识绘图

5 篇文章 0 订阅
4 篇文章 0 订阅

NO.1 环境搭建及初识绘图

分享内容

以PPT的形式分享学习所得,本节介绍使用matplotlib绘图需要搭建的开发环境(Python3/Anaconda/Pycharm)以及下载来源;然后简单介绍绘制一张基础图标所需要的一些Python语句,包含一张图绘制多个绘图区域、添加图片标题、x或y轴标签、绘制图例以及绘制图片标记的语句。最后,给出一段自己编的示例代码,以便交流。
本人菜鸟一枚,难免错漏,见谅!
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述

代码分享

'''---
coded by Warm Wang
---'''
# -*- coding: utf-8 -*-
from pylab import *
mpl.rcParams['font.sans-serif'] = ['SimHei']#解决图片中中文不显示问题
fig,(ax1,ax2)=plt.subplots(1,2)#新建绘图,并划分为两个绘图区域
stitle=fig.suptitle('one example with two subplots')#绘图的总标题
plot1=ax1.plot([0,1,2,3,4,5,6],[9,4,1,0,1,4,9],'r-',label='plot1')#区域1绘图
ax1.set_title('曲线')#区域1标题
ax1.set_xlabel('x轴')#区域1x轴标签
ax1.set_ylabel('y轴')
plot2=ax2.plot([0,1,2,3,4,5,6],[0,1,2,3,3,2,1],'b--',label='plot2')
ax2.set_title('折线')#区域2标题
ax2.set_xlabel('x轴')#区域2x轴标签
#ax2.set_ylabel('y轴')
fig.legend(loc='upper right')
#建立所有曲线的图例,单曲线可用handles=[plot1]表示;ax1.legend()来对区域1做图例
ax2.annotate('leap',xy=(3,3),xytext=(3,2),arrowprops=dict(facecolor='black',shrink=0.05),)
#对区域2的绘图做标记
plt.show()#显示绘图
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值